The start of your on-campus Knox College experience is coming soon! We are so excited to be welcoming students to campus over the next month, culminating in your new student orientation September 8th - 13th.
Key Dates to Remember:
- Cross Country (M/W), Golf (M/W), Soccer (M/W), Volleyball teams move-In: August 17th
- International Student arrival: September 3rd
- TRIO Bridge program arrival: September 5th
- New Students orientation begins and move in: September 8th
Athletes, International students, and TRIO students: please be on the lookout for detailed arrival information from the athletic department, international admissions team, or TRIO office.
When new students (residential, commuter, and transfer) arrive on campus on September 8, you will first check-in at the Ford Center for Fine Arts (CFA) building (500 S. Prairie Street) to pick-up your name tag, keys, and complete arrival paperwork! Staff from various offices will be available to answer questions at check-in. After check-in, residential students will proceed to their residence hall, where student athletes and orientation leaders will be available to provide directions and assist with move-in.
